An Image Watermarking Scheme Based on Local Feature Adaptive Filtering

Zhang Xing, Liu Shuai

Abstract


This article is about a watermarking algorithm that based on adaptive filtering of local property, which is for verifying copyright information of images; this method is relies on a model of image degradation and restoration. The algorithm assumes that the degradation parameters of electronic equipment to be known, firstly, using the image binarization automatically generate digital watermarking signal; in addition, according to the characteristics of image noise, to use the image degradation / adaptive filtering algorithm that based on local feature restoration model of embedding and extracting watermark signal to the host image; finally, verify the proposed algorithm with experiments. In view of the experimental results, it reveals that the algorithm has good invisibility and robustness.

Keywords


Image degradation / restoration; adaptive filtering local feature; digital watermarking.
